摘要:代碼實(shí)現(xiàn)表的長度,即具體有多少個(gè)位置選擇一個(gè)合適的素?cái)?shù)取的絕對(duì)值修改添加即除以由于在方法中有對(duì)進(jìn)行操作,在往新哈希表中存數(shù)據(jù)時(shí)應(yīng)該用計(jì)算相應(yīng)的值哈希表的均攤復(fù)雜度為,有這么好的性能其中一個(gè)原因是它犧牲了順序性。 哈希沖突的解決方法 鏈地址法 在Java8開始,當(dāng)哈希沖突達(dá)到一定的程度,每一個(gè)位置從鏈表轉(zhuǎn)化為紅黑樹。 時(shí)間復(fù)雜度分析 showImg(https://segmentfaul...
摘要:基于版本基于版本。由于中英行文差異,完全的逐字逐句翻譯會(huì)很冗余啰嗦。譯者在翻譯中同時(shí)參考了谷歌百度有道翻譯的譯文以及編程思想第四版中文版的部分內(nèi)容對(duì)其翻譯死板,生造名詞,語言精煉度差問題進(jìn)行規(guī)避和改正。 來源:LingCoder/OnJava8 主譯: LingCoder 參譯: LortSir 校對(duì):nickChenyx E-mail: 本書原作者為 [美] Bru...
摘要:配置實(shí)現(xiàn)接口,同時(shí)重寫方法。再未登錄時(shí)訪問非許可的接口會(huì)轉(zhuǎn)到登錄。效果如下登錄成功后訪問我們很方便的實(shí)現(xiàn)了登錄授權(quán),使得我們的得到了保護(hù)。如需指定區(qū)分不同角色下的訪問權(quán)限時(shí)只要在加上一下注解即可。 一、構(gòu)建項(xiàng)目 話不多說直接開始。 pom.xml: spring security的核心依賴如下 org.springframework.boot spring-boot-starter...
摘要:構(gòu)建工程創(chuàng)建一個(gè)工程,在它的程序入口加上開啟調(diào)度任務(wù)。創(chuàng)建定時(shí)任務(wù)創(chuàng)建一個(gè)定時(shí)任務(wù),每過在控制臺(tái)打印當(dāng)前時(shí)間。通過在方法上加注解,表明該方法是一個(gè)調(diào)度任務(wù)。 這篇文章將介紹怎么通過spring去做調(diào)度任務(wù)。 構(gòu)建工程 創(chuàng)建一個(gè)Springboot工程,在它的程序入口加上@EnableScheduling,開啟調(diào)度任務(wù)。 @SpringBootApplication @EnableSch...
摘要:有一些隱藏的官方?jīng)]有暴露出來下面是一些示例可以方便開發(fā)獲取狀態(tài)返回樣例停止返回樣例提交返回樣例 Spark有一些隱藏的API, 官方?jīng)]有暴露出來, 下面是一些示例, 可以方便開發(fā) 獲取job狀態(tài) curl http://spark-cluster-ip:6066/v1/submissions/status/driver-20151008145126-0000? 返回樣例 { ac...
暫無介紹